Windows嵌入式开发:运行库高效配置与管理全攻略
|
在Windows嵌入式开发中,运行库的配置与管理是确保应用程序稳定运行的关键环节。运行库包含了程序运行所需的各种动态链接库(DLL)和系统组件,合理配置可以提升性能并减少资源占用。 开发过程中,应优先选择轻量级的运行库版本,避免引入不必要的依赖。例如,使用Visual C++的“最小化运行库”选项,可以显著减少部署包的大小,同时保持功能完整。 对于需要跨平台或兼容性的项目,建议使用静态链接方式打包运行库,这样可以避免目标设备上缺少特定DLL的问题。但需注意,静态链接会增加可执行文件的体积。 在部署时,应确保所有依赖的运行库都已正确安装,并通过工具如Dependency Walker检查是否存在缺失或冲突的库文件。这有助于提前发现潜在问题,避免运行时错误。 定期更新运行库也是维护系统稳定性的重要措施。通过Windows Update或手动安装最新的补丁,可以修复已知漏洞并优化性能,提升整体系统的安全性和可靠性。
AI绘图结果,仅供参考 利用部署工具如ClickOnce或MSI安装包,可以简化运行库的安装流程,确保用户无需手动干预即可完成配置。这种方式特别适用于面向非技术用户的嵌入式应用。 对运行库进行版本控制和日志记录,有助于快速定位和解决运行时异常。通过分析日志信息,开发者可以更高效地优化代码和配置策略。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

